随着科技的飞速发展,编程逐渐成为各行各业必备的技能。传统的编程方式对于非专业人员来说,门槛较高。近年来,低代码开发应运而生,成为引领未来编程潮流的利器。本文将从低代码开发的定义、优势、应用场景等方面进行探讨,以期为读者提供有益的参考。
一、低代码开发的定义
低代码开发(Low-Code Development)是指通过图形化界面和少量代码实现应用程序开发的过程。它将复杂的编程逻辑封装在可视化的组件中,用户只需通过拖拽、配置等操作,即可完成应用程序的开发。低代码开发降低了编程门槛,使非专业人员也能参与到应用开发中来。

二、低代码开发的优势
1. 降低开发成本:低代码开发平台提供了丰富的组件和模板,开发者可以快速搭建应用程序,从而缩短开发周期,降低人力成本。
2. 提高开发效率:低代码开发平台将复杂逻辑封装在组件中,开发者无需编写大量代码,从而提高开发效率。
3. 适应性强:低代码开发平台支持跨平台开发,能够适应不同操作系统、设备和终端。
4. 易于维护:低代码开发平台具有可视化界面,便于开发者理解和维护。
5. 降低技术门槛:低代码开发平台降低了编程门槛,使得非专业人员也能参与到应用开发中来。
三、低代码开发的应用场景
1. 企业级应用:低代码开发平台可以快速构建企业级应用,如ERP、CRM等,满足企业内部管理需求。
2. 移动应用:低代码开发平台支持跨平台开发,适用于开发各类移动应用,如电商、社交、办公等。
3. 网站开发:低代码开发平台可以快速搭建网站,满足企业、个人展示和宣传需求。
4. 物联网应用:低代码开发平台支持物联网设备接入,适用于智能家居、智能交通等领域。
5. 教育培训:低代码开发平台可以用于教育培训,帮助初学者快速掌握编程技能。
低代码开发作为引领未来编程潮流的利器,具有降低开发成本、提高开发效率、适应性强等优势。在当今信息化时代,低代码开发将成为企业、个人提升竞争力的关键。相信在不久的将来,低代码开发将更加成熟,为我国经济社会发展注入新的活力。